Seeing as the Ravens have interest in Ricky Jean Francois, a rotational DT from San Fran, I went to watch tape on NFL game pass of all the games he started in. RDE and LDE are not great needs on the line, Arthur Jones, and Pernell McPhee are developing into solid players, I think both have a lot of potential. Haloti Ngata is still an all pro caliber player. NT is where we need a drastic improvement at, both Terrence Cody and Kemo were awful this season.
So I watched Jean Francois starting NT against the Jets back in week 4. Despite an under sized weight on paper to play NT (295 lbs), he holds him self well at the LOS, and didn't get pushed off much by Nick Mangold. He was a force in run defense and would constantly hold Mangold off and sometimes Slauson to allow the supporting cast to stop the run. He also had a sack on Sanchez, and should have really had another one as he did all the work on Slauson to allow Aldon Smith to make the sack. He plays a lot bigger and stronger than his weight suggests, and he looks to be in great shape, and is probably heavier than what they're listing him as. He is a hybrid between a NT and a DE on a 3 man front, and would be an instant upgrade over Cody at NT. He would also provide good depth at both DE spots should he need to move over as he has started and played well at that position too.
It would be a nice cheap signing that would be a typical Ozzie move. He's a decent fit for our defense and is still relatively young.
